一、Linux操作系統組成部分: 系統調用:任何一個主機,它對底層硬件實現抽象后所得到(輸出)的接口 System call。 庫:在操作系統之上附加的一段可共享的可用代碼段,這一代碼段被分成多個模塊,每一個模塊就叫一個庫文件。 API:Application Programing ...
本文主要是記錄下RedHat系列的軟件包管理。 內容分為以下三個部分:二進制包的管理,源代碼包的管理,腳本安裝 一 二進制包的管理 . 概念 主要有RPM和YUM這兩種包管理。 兩種包管理各有用處,其中主要區別是:YUM使用簡單但需要聯網,YUM會去網上的YUM包源去獲取所需要的軟件包。而RPM的需要的操作精度比較細,需要我們做的事情比較多。 . . RPM 主要的操作 卸載 rpm e node ...
2012-01-03 16:01 0 6955 推薦指數:
一、Linux操作系統組成部分: 系統調用:任何一個主機,它對底層硬件實現抽象后所得到(輸出)的接口 System call。 庫:在操作系統之上附加的一段可共享的可用代碼段,這一代碼段被分成多個模塊,每一個模塊就叫一個庫文件。 API:Application Programing ...
1) 常用的查詢已安裝的軟件包信息的命令: a) rpm –qa:顯示目前操作系統上安裝的全部軟件 ...
軟件包管理 1 RPM軟件包管理 1.1 RPM軟件包簡介: RPM(Red Hat Package Manager,Red Hat軟件包管理器)是一種開放的軟件包管理系統,按照GPL條款發行,可以運行於各種Linux系統上。RPM簡化了Linux系統安裝、卸裝、更新和升級的過程,只需要 ...
RPM(RedHat Package Manager),RedHat軟件包管理工具,類似windows里面的setup.exe。 是Linux這系列操作系統里面的打包安裝工具,它雖然是RedHat的標志,但理念是通用的。 RPM包的命名格式 ...
一、流行的兩種軟件包管理機制 1、Debian Linux首先提出“軟件包”的管理機制——Deb軟件包 將應用程序的二進制文件、配置文檔、man/info幫助頁面等文件合並打包在一個文件中,用戶使用軟件包管理器直接操作軟件包,完成獲取、安裝、卸載、查詢等操作。 2、Redhat ...
dpkg Debain 的包管理工具,Ubuntu 最早是作為 Debain 的一個分支出現的,屬於Debain陣營,所以自然支持 dpkg aptitude 更友好的高級包管理工具,它是 APT 的高級字符和命令行前端,它會記住哪些包是你安裝的,哪些是為了依賴關系而安裝的,在不被 ...
OPKG 軟件包管理 來源 https://openwrt.org/zh/docs/techref/opkg opkg 工具 (一個 ipkg 變種) 是一個用來從本地軟件倉庫或互聯網軟件倉庫上下載並安裝 OpenWrt 軟件包的輕量型軟件包管理器。 GNU ...
1、源代碼管理 絕大多數開源軟件都是直接以源代碼形式發布的,一般會被打包為tar.gz 的歸檔壓縮文件。程序源代碼需要編譯為二進制可執行文件后才能夠運行使用。源代碼的基本編譯流程為 ./configure:解壓縮后運行該命令,它主要檢查編譯環境、相關庫文件以及配置參數並生成 ...